Corporacion America Airports SA (CAAP)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.47, falling short of the consensus estimate of $0.508 by -7.48%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in this release. The stock declined by 0.11% following the announcement, reflecting market disappointment with the earnings miss.

CAAP’s Q1 2026 results were affected by a combination of operational and macroeconomic factors common to the airport and infrastructure sector. The EPS shortfall of $0.038 per share may have been driven by higher operating costs, currency volatility in certain Latin American markets, or lower-than-expected passenger traffic growth during the quarter. While total revenue was not provided, cost pressures from increased energy prices, labor expenses, and airport maintenance could have compressed margins. The company’s geographic exposure to countries such as Argentina, Italy, and Brazil may have introduced additional exchange-rate headwinds, as local currencies depreciated against the U.S. dollar. Additionally, seasonal factors in the first quarter—traditionally a lower travel period in some regions—may have contributed to a weaker revenue mix. Despite the EPS miss, CAAP’s diversified portfolio of airport concessions remains a structural advantage, though near-term profitability appears constrained by rising input costs and inflationary dynamics.
